Asbestos remediation services involve the safe identification, removal, and management of asbestos-containing materials within a property. These services typically include thorough inspections to detect asbestos presence, followed by specialized procedures to eliminate or contain the hazardous materials. The goal is to reduce health risks associated with asbestos exposure, which can cause serious respiratory issues and other health problems. Professionals use appropriate techniques and equipment to ensure that asbestos is handled properly, minimizing disturbance and preventing the release of fibers into the air.

Properties that commonly require asbestos remediation include residential homes built before the 1980s, commercial buildings, industrial facilities, and public structures such as schools and hospitals. These properties often contain asbestos in insulation, roofing, flooring, or wall materials. Asbestos was widely used in construction due to its durability and fire-resistant properties, but its presence can become problematic over time as materials age or are disturbed during maintenance or remodeling activities.

Assessment Costs - An asbestos inspection typically ranges from $300 to $800, depending on the property's size and complexity. Larger or more complex sites may cost more for thorough testing and analysis.
Removal Expenses - The cost to remove asbestos materials generally falls between $2,000 and $15,000. Factors influencing the price include the extent of contamination and the type of materials involved.
Containment and Encapsulation - Containment or encapsulation services can cost from $1,500 to $6,000, depending on the area size and the method used to prevent asbestos fibers from spreading.
Post-Remediation Testing - Confirmatory testing after remediation typically costs between $200 and $600. This ensures that asbestos levels are within safe limits before re-occupying the space.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
